Who we are looking for:

We are looking for a technical dynamic and experienced Paint Shop Manufacturing Engineering Manager to join our growing team. The ideal candidate will play a key role in overseeing and managing the execution of paint systems and operations from initiation to completion. The Paint Shop Manufacturing Engineering Manager will collaborate with cross-functional teams ensuring that projects are delivered on time within scope and within budget. Your leadership will be instrumental in ensuring efficient production processes maintaining high-quality standards and driving innovation in the Paint Shop.


What you get to do:

  • Prioritize safety above all else to protect our team members partners and customers.
  • Develop comprehensive project plans outlining timelines milestones and resource requirements.
  • Collaborate with stakeholders to define paint operations scope and objectives.
  • Identify potential risks and develop contingency plans.
  • Lead and coordinate cross-functional teams in the execution of paints operations on time and within budget.
  • Monitor project progress ensuring adherence to timelines and quality standards.
  • Implement effective paint management process control plans and methodologies.
  • Allocate resources appropriately to ensure operational success.
  • Work closely with department heads to secure necessary resources and support.
  • Communicate program status issues and risks regularly to stakeholders.
  • Drive the development and execution of training programs to enhance the skills and capabilities of the Manufacturing Engineering team of the Paint Shop.


What you bring to the team:

  • Bachelors degree in Chemical Engineering Manufacturing Engineering Mechanical Engineering or a related engineering field is preferred. While a degree is preferred we value hands-on experience and a proven track record of success in similar roles as a suitable substitute and encourage candidates to apply who can demonstrate relevant and commensurate professional experience.
  • 15 years of relevant experience in Paint Shop management in a manufacturing or assembly environment preferably with a focus on launching new car models in the automotive industry.
  • In-depth knowledge of paint application processes and equipment in the automotive industry.
  • Strong process management skills with a focus on delivering results while optimizing processes and improving efficiency.
  • Knowledge of Lean manufacturing principles and process improvement methodologies (Six Sigma Kaizen etc.).
  • Strong analytical decision-making and problem-solving skills.
  • Strong leadership communication and interpersonal skills with experience leading cross-functional teams and managing stakeholders to achieve common goals
  • Highly adaptable and proactive excelling in fast-paced start-up and new model launch environments.
  • Proficiency with engineering software and tools.
  • Proficiency with Microsoft Office (Outlook Teams Word Excel PowerPoint).
